Celltech’s story

Celltech’s history go back to 1982, when Alexander Batteries was established specializing in batteries for PMR terminals. Later, as the market’s growing need for mobile phones, program expand batteries and accessories for same.

For over 30 years, the passion to develop and improve battery solutions transformed a small local business to an international operator, which has offices in Denmark, Sweden, Finland and Norway. Cell tech is owned by Swedish Addtech AB, listed on the Stockholm Stock Exchange. Addtech’s history goes back over a hundred years back.

Together with our sister companies, we are the market leader and the largest battery supplier in the Nordic countries.

Addtech is a Swedish publicly listed technology trading group. The business comprises about 130 independent companies with 2900 employess that sell high-tech products and solutions to customers chiefly in the manufacturing and infrastructure sectors in around 20 countries. Addtech creates optimal conditions for the profitability and growth of subsidiaries.
